  • 10) Student declaration

    Please read carefully and sign where indicated
    • I declare that the information on this application is complete and accurate
    • I understand that if I submit false information, or fail to give complete information, financial assistance will be withdrawn, and that all awards are subject to funds being available and Gateshead College reserves the right to reduce or refuse any requests if they are deemed excessive or if funds are limited
    • I understand that it is my responsibility to inform the DWP/Jobcentre Plus if I receive an award for living costs or housing costs that are already being covered by welfare benefits
    • I understand that all awards are subject to confirmation of attendance (92%), acceptable behaviour which means adhering to the Student Code of Conduct and the funding being available
    • I understand that if I use fraudulent methods to obtain financial support, the College disciplinary procedure will apply or we may refer matters to the Department of Education or the Police
    • I will provide any additional information which may be required
    • If successful with my application I agree to repay, in whole or in part, at the discretion of Gateshead College, the award made to me if, in the view of the College I withdraw from my course without good reason, and I agree to Gateshead College making payment(s) to a third party where appropriate
    • I understand I may be requested to return items purchased on my behalf, or purchased with an award, to the College, on completion of my course
    • I will inform the Support Funds Team immediately of any change in my circumstances at any time which might affect my entitlement to support
    • I have fully read and agree to the terms and conditions supplied with the application form
    • I understand, if any information I provide raises a concern regarding safeguarding, I may be contacted

     

    I understand that this bursary may be awarded from the 16-18 Bursary Fund or Gateshead College Foundation as determined by available funds.

     

    Gateshead College does not accept any liability for any activities, actions or the purchase of goods or services relating to awards made from discretionary funds.
